FIELD, 2012

Field was exhibited in COLLECT 2012.  A collection of vessels that is reflected from the landscape I live in now, East Sussex.

Like many people who have and are living in the south east the country side has been a source of inspiration.  Eric Ravilious was especially inspired by the landscape of the south downs and I enjoy his watercolours and style. 

Field is a reflection of the start of Spring. Using yellow as a symbol that the Chinese use for happiness, glory and wisdom. It is also for pulsating life and sun. 

There are many fields filled with rapeseed that surround the countryside every Spring that have seeped into my visual work.

14 Vessels. Thrown porcelain, oxidations and reduction firings 1280°
